How does a bubble sorting algorithm work
WebSep 24, 2024 · Bubble sort is one of the most straightforward sorting algorithms. The basic idea is that a given list or sequence of data is verified for the order of neighboring elements by comparing them with each other. Elements are swapped if the order does not match the expected result. WebBubble sorts work like this: Start at the beginning of the list. Compare the first value in the list with the next one up. If the first value is bigger, swap the positions of the two values. …
How does a bubble sorting algorithm work
Did you know?
WebFeb 3, 2024 · How Does the C Program for Bubble Sort Work? As mentioned, the C program for bubble sort works by comparing and swapping adjacent elements in an array. Let’s understand this in a step-by-step method: Suppose we want to sort an array, let’s name it arr, with n elements in ascending order; this is how the bubble sort algorithm will work. WebThis helps to implement the code in the future. Let us try to make the algorithm for the Bubble sort. For i = 0 to n-1 Repeat 2 nd Step. For j = i + 1 to n – i Repeat This Step. if A [j] > A [k] à Swap A [j] and A [k] à [end of inner for loop] à [end if outer for loop] End Of The Process. The above is the process of the Bubble sort algorithm.
WebIn this step, we’re going to look at a method of sorting lists called bubble sort. The bubble sort algorithm is one of the simplest sorting algorithms to implement. It’s not a very widely used sorting algorithm, but is more often used as a teaching tool to introduce the concept of sorting. This means that virtually every student of computer ... WebAn example of a sorting algorithm is bubble sort. This is a simple algorithm used for taking a list of unordered numbers and putting them into the correct order. Each run through the list, from ...
WebDec 18, 2024 · While slightly outperforming bubble sort when working with small lists, selection sort is still viewed as a very slow algorithm. And, sadly, selection sort doesn’t have a whole lot going for it.
WebAn insertion sort is less complex and efficient than a merge sort, but more efficient than a bubble sort. An insertion sort compares values in turn, starting with the second value in the...
WebFeb 20, 2024 · The bubble sort algorithm is a reliable sorting algorithm. This algorithm has a worst-case time complexity of O (n2). The bubble sort has a space complexity of O (1). The number of swaps in bubble sort equals the number of inversion pairs in the given array. When the array elements are few and the array is nearly sorted, bubble sort is ... tttlyWebarticles from the 1962 ACM Conference on Sorting [11] do not use the term bubble sort, although the “sorting by exchange” algorithm is mentioned. With no obvious definitive origin of the name “bubble sort”, we investi-gated its origins by consulting early journal articles as well as professional and pedagogical texts. ph of 10-8 m hclWebApr 13, 2024 · April 4, 2024, "When former Google CEO Eric Schmidt tells how the company’s ad algorithm—the heart of its financial success—was revamped, here’s what he says: One Friday afternoon in May 2002, (company co-founder) Larry Page was playing around on the Google site, typing in search terms and seeing what sort of results and ads he’d get back. tttkc.infoWebWhat is Bubble Sort? Bubble sort is a sorting algorithm that uses comparison methods to sort an array. The algorithm compares pairs of elements in an array and swaps them if … tttl leatherWebSep 24, 2024 · How Does A Bubble Sort Algorithm Work? Let’s take a look at a visual example of bubble sort before divinginto its technicalities. Consider the following array. … ph of 15% ammonium hydroxideWebApr 13, 2024 · We want to equip our chat program with rules that identify the most important “features” of this request, such as “Seinfeld script” and “bubble sort algorithm” (a basic mathematical ... ph of 1m nitric acidWebFeb 1, 2014 · How does Bubble Sort Work? First Pass:. Bubble sort starts with very first two elements, comparing them to check which one is greater. Second Pass:. Third Pass:. Now, the array is already sorted, but our algorithm does not know if it is completed. The … However any sorting algorithm can be made stable by considering indexes as … Sorting Strings using Bubble Sort; Sort an array according to count of set bits; Sort … Selection sort is a simple and efficient sorting algorithm that works by … ttt live facebook